Neoadjuvant Immunotherapy Combined With the Anti-GDF-15 Antibody Visugromab to Treat Muscle Invasive Bladder Cancer

NCT06059547 · Status: ACTIVE_NOT_RECRUITING · Phase: PHASE2 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 31

Last updated 2025-12-11

No results posted yet for this study

Summary

This is a multi-center, stratified and single-blinded Phase 2 trial of neoadjuvant immunotherapy in combination with the anti-GDF15 antibody visugromab (CTL-002) for the treatment of participants with MIBC set to undergo radical Cystectomy (RC)/Re-TURBT who cannot receive or refuse to receive cisplatin-based chemotherapy.
